What Is a Creator Clipping Network and How Can Brands Use One to Grow Faster
A creator clipping network is a coordinated group of content creators who edit and distribute short-form video clips on behalf of brands. Instead of brands managing dozens of freelancers individually, a creator clipping network provides centralized infrastructure for scaling content distribution.
This article explains what creator clipping networks are, how they work, and why brands use them to accelerate growth.
What Is a Creator Clipping Network?
A creator clipping network connects brands with a pool of clippers who can edit content and post it to their own social accounts.
The typical structure includes:
- Clippers who edit long-form video into short-form clips
- Creator accounts where clips are posted and distributed
- A management layer that coordinates assignments, quality control, and payouts
- Reporting systems that track performance across all posts
Unlike hiring individual freelancers, a creator clipping network provides scale. Brands can access dozens or hundreds of clippers through a single relationship.

How Creator Clipping Networks Work
The workflow for a creator clipping network follows a standard pattern.
Step 1: Brand provides source content. This is typically long-form video such as podcast episodes, webinars, product demos, or event recordings. Step 2: Network assigns clippers. Based on the campaign scope, clippers are assigned to create clips. Each clipper may produce 5 to 20 clips depending on the source material. Step 3: Clippers edit and submit clips. Clips are created according to brand briefs and submitted for review. Step 4: Quality control. A management layer reviews clips for quality, hook effectiveness, formatting, and brand alignment. Step 5: Clips are posted. Approved clips are posted to creator accounts across target platforms. Step 6: Performance tracking. The network tracks views, engagement, and other metrics across all clips and provides consolidated reporting.
Why Brands Use Creator Clipping Networks
Three primary factors drive brands toward creator clipping networks.
1. Scale Without Headcount
Hiring in-house editors and managing freelancers creates operational overhead. A creator clipping network provides access to editing capacity and distribution without adding headcount.
This is particularly valuable for brands that need volume. Running 50 or 100 clips per week requires infrastructure that most brands cannot build internally.
2. Built-In Distribution
Editors give you clips. A creator clipping network gives you clips and audiences.
Because clippers post to their own accounts, brands access audiences they would not reach otherwise. This solves the distribution problem that many brands face when posting only to their own accounts.

3. Managed Operations
Coordinating dozens of clippers is complex. Tracking assignments, reviewing quality, verifying posts, and processing payments can consume significant time.
A creator clipping network handles these operations. Brands work with a single point of contact rather than managing each clipper individually.
What to Look for in a Creator Clipping Network
Not all networks are equal. Evaluate these factors when choosing a creator clipping network.
Network size. Larger networks can handle bigger campaigns and provide more distribution reach. Vetting process. How does the network screen clippers? Quality control at the clipper level prevents problems downstream. Platform coverage. Does the network cover the platforms you need? TikTok, Instagram Reels, YouTube Shorts, and X are the primary short-form platforms. Quality control process. How are clips reviewed before posting? Strong QC prevents brand damage from low-quality or off-message content. Reporting capabilities. Can the network provide consolidated reporting across all clips and accounts? Payout infrastructure. Does the network handle payments to clippers? This removes significant administrative burden from brands.

Creator Clipping Network vs. Influencer Marketing
Creator clipping networks are not the same as influencer marketing.
| Creator Clipping Network | Influencer Marketing |
|---|---|
| Distributes brand content | Creates original content |
| Lower cost per post | Higher cost per post |
| High volume focus | High impact focus |
| Message controlled by brand | Message shaped by creator |
| Scalable | Limited by budget |
Influencer marketing works when brands want a creator's unique voice and audience. Creator clipping networks work when brands want distribution of their own content at scale.
